When you provide the lyrics yourself, Youka uses them as a precise reference for synchronization. The AI matches each word in your text to the exact moment it’s sung, producing tighter timing than transcription alone.

Two ways to add lyrics

Provide lyrics manually (this page) — paste or type the lyrics text before creating the karaoke. AI transcription — let Youka detect the lyrics from the audio automatically. Use this when you don’t have the lyrics. See AI Transcription.

When to provide lyrics manually

Use this option when:
  • You have the song’s lyrics available
  • You want the most accurate word-level timing
  • The vocals are complex, heavily layered, or in a less common language
  • You’re working with a song that has unusual pronunciations or stylized spelling

How to paste your lyrics

1

Open the Create Karaoke page

Click Create Karaoke from the Youka home page, then upload your file or paste a URL.
2

Select I have lyrics

In the lyrics section, choose I have lyrics. A text area will appear.
3

Paste or type the lyrics

Paste the lyrics into the text area. You can also:
  • Click Paste to insert text from your clipboard
  • Click Search (available when the Youka Extension is connected) to automatically find lyrics based on the song title
4

Check the formatting

Review the lyrics and make sure they follow these guidelines:
  • Each sung line is on its own line
  • Section headers like [Chorus] or [Verse 1] are removed, unless you want them displayed on screen
  • Background vocals in parentheses are included if you want them shown
  • Spelling is accurate — the AI syncs exactly what you provide
Example:
I've been waiting for a day like this
Come around, come around, come around
Would you take my hand?
5

Select the lyrics language

Choose the language your lyrics are written in. This helps the AI understand pronunciation patterns, handle special characters correctly, and improve sync accuracy. Youka supports 50+ languages including English, Spanish, French, Japanese, Korean, Arabic, and more.
6

Click Create Karaoke

Click Create Karaoke. The AI will analyze the audio and match every word in your lyrics to the music. This typically takes 1–2 minutes.

Tips for accurate sync

  • Accurate spelling matters. The AI aligns what you type — typos cause misalignment.
  • Match the sung text, not the printed text. If the recording omits a word or adds an ad-lib, adjust the lyrics to reflect what’s actually sung.
  • Remove non-sung text. Strip out headers, annotations, and anything that doesn’t appear as sung words in the audio.
If the sync is slightly off in places after creation, use the Manual Sync tool in Studio to adjust individual word and line timings without re-creating the project.
